Minutes — Management Meeting, Tollbridge Fabrication. Present: R. Masek (chair), D. Ufford, L. Crain. Topic: proposed joint venture with Arvenne Coatings. Terms reviewed; equity split unresolved. Legal flagged IP carve-outs. Ufford to draft counterproposal within two weeks. Crain to model capex scenarios. Decision deferred to next session. For the incoming director, the confidential note on related business plans appears below.

board note of kageg-bahof: The renewal with Holwynax Holdings closes at $2 million a year, 5 percent below the last contract. Project Ulaath slips by two quarters because of the supplier delay.

Handover — Thumbnail Queue (Snapforge)

For the upcoming release: Snapforge's thumbnail generation queue is stable, but note two items. First, the worker pool autoscaler caps at 12 instances; bursts above that backlog into the overflow topic, which drains within roughly twenty minutes. Second, the 0.8 release changes the image-hash scheme, so pre-existing thumbnails regenerate lazily on first request — expect elevated CPU for a day. If the queue admin console needs unlocking during cutover, use the passphrase below.

unlock words, yawig-kagef: gordor-holvan-ulaael-pramir-ulaiel-tamdor

# Tilecrate Cache — Limits & Quotas

Hey, thanks for reviewing this. Tilecrate sits between the Mapling renderer and clients, caching rendered tiles in memory plus a disk tier. From a security angle, the things that matter: per-client quota stops one tenant from evicting everyone else's tiles, entry TTLs bound how long a revoked layer can linger, and the upload size cap prevents oversized tile abuse. All of it is enforced in one module, not scattered around. The enforced constants are these.

tuning constants:
QUOTAS = {
    "ralael": 1,
    "druath": 1,
    "oliwyn": 2,
    "holath": 10,
}

Building Access Wiki — Holiday Opening Hours (Night Shift)

During the holiday period (22 December to 4 January), Dunmere Exchange operates on reduced hours. The front entrance locks at 18:00, and night shift staff must use the west stairwell door. Cleaning crews finish by 21:00, after which the building runs unstaffed at ground level. Report any door faults to Facilities via the usual ticket queue. The west stairwell reader accepts the night-access code below.

staff pass of kawip-hawef = bdg-QLP-2